Subject: Session-token refresh bug — what you need to know

Hi, welcome to the Larkfield on-call rotation. Quick heads-up: there's a known bug where session tokens issued by the Pellwick gateway occasionally fail to refresh, logging users out mid-session. It spikes around the nightly cache flush at 02:00 UTC. A fix is in review; until it ships, the mitigation is restarting the token service pods, which is safe and takes under a minute. Symptoms, dashboards, and the step-by-step mitigation are all documented on this page.

wiki page, tagef-bajog: https://grafana.nelvrocorp.corp/projects/pages/display/fa238a928afe

Subject: Quickstore 4.2 — bloom filter now fronts the KV layer

Plugin authors: starting with this release, Quickstore places a bloom filter ahead of the key-value store. Negative lookups return faster; false positives fall through safely. No API changes are required on your side. Verify your plugin against the staging build referenced below.

session token of fahif-tadup = htk3_9c7

**Q: What happens when the Meridix upstream API starts failing?**

A: The Pellwright gateway trips a circuit breaker after five consecutive errors within thirty seconds. Requests then return cached responses for two minutes before a half-open probe. Don't retry manually during the open state — it resets the timer. The breaker thresholds and tuning guide live here:

operations page: https://jira.qorvelsys.internal/browse/pages/browse/pages